NYC Jogger Calls Incident Where Woman Threw Bottle And Used Racial Slurs A 'Hate Crime'

Tiffany Johnson, the Queens jogger who was attacked by a woman who threw a bottle at her while screaming racial slurs, is speaking out about the shocking incident. 'It’s a […]
